Deployment from a moving vehicle
Points of attention for the deployment of the drone from a moving vehicle
⢠Whenever possible, mobilize two operators for the deployment of the drone from a moving
vehicle.
⢠If only one operator is available, favor the Take-off from a moving vehicle procedure.
⢠If required by FreeFlight 6 USA and whenever possible, perform the magnetometer calibration
of the drone far away from any metallic mass.
⢠When preparing a deployment from a ship or an armored vehicle, always keep your powered-
on drone in your hand, away from the floor of the ship or the roof of the vehicle.
⢠The GPS fix is not mandatory to deploy the drone from a moving vehicle, but it is always
recommended.
⢠In the unlikely situation where the drone becomes disoriented after a launch or a take-off from
a moving vehicle (uncontrolled rotation), quickly and firmly take back the commands of the
drone in rotation and elevation (left joystick laterally and upward in default mode) to retrieve
flight control.
Hand launch from a moving vehicle
Parrot recommends mobilizing two operators for this procedure: one operator launches the drone
while another operator controls the drone with both joysticks of the Skycontroller.
Warning: Be especially careful when hand launching ANAFI U SA from a moving vehicle. It requires
complete focus. Do not allow yourself to become distracted and stay aware of your surroundings.
Activate the hand launch option from PREFERENCES > Interface of FreeFlight 6 USA (refer to the
āPREFERENCES / Interfaceā section of this guide for more information).
Press Power to power on ANAFI USA and position the drone in the palm of the operatorās hand. On
the screen, the green TAKE OFF box has been replaced by a blue HAND LAUNCH box.
Important: Stabilize the speed and direction of the vehicle as much as possible. The maximum vehicle
speed for this feature is 30 km/h in a straight line. Do not operate this feature in wind or downwind.
Press Take-Off/Land on the Skycontroller or activate the launch directly from the blue HAND
LAUNCH box on the screen. Motors and propellers start to rotate slowly, and an animation on screen
confirms the activation of a hand launch.
When the propellersā speed has stabilized:
1. Briefly and rapidly lift ANAFI USA upward with your open hand, and toward a direction free
of all obstacles.
2. Immediately push the left joystick of the Skycontroller (elevation) upward (default control
mode) to give altitude to the droneās altitude.
3. If possible, monitor the behavior of the hovering drone for 10 to 30 seconds before beginning
the mission, to confirm the convergence of all sensorsā estimates.
